Chickpea Patties

Makes 6 - 8 patties



Ingredients

  • 1 can of chickpeas, 15oz., drained

  • 1/2 tsp garlic powder

  • 1 tbsp parsley

  • 1/4 cup flour

  • 1 tsp cumin

  • 1/4 cup parmesan cheese

  • 2-3 tbsp water

  • Salt & pepper to taste

  • 2 tbsp canola/vegetable oil


Dipping Sauce *optional*:

  • 1/2 cup tahini (sesame seed paste)

  • Juice from 1/2 a lemon

  • Water to thin out the mixture (about 1/4 cup)

  • Dash of salt


Directions

  1. Using a food processor (or a potato masher if you don't have a processor), combine the chickpeas, garlic powder, parsley, flour, cumin, cheese, water, salt and pepper. Blend and mix well until a smooth dough-like texture is created.

  2. Spoon the mixture into your hand and roll to create a ball. Flatten and set aside. Repeat until your mixture is complete.

  3. Meanwhile, heat the oil on medium-high heat in a pan.

  4. Once the oil is heated, gently place each patty into the oil. Pan fry for about 1 - 2 minutes, then gently turn each patty over. Cook until golden brown on both sides.

  5. Carefully remove the patties from the oil and set them aside on a paper towel to drain any excess oil.

  6. To make the sauce, simply combine all ingredients in a bowl and stir until smooth.

  7. Serve patties on a dish with the sauce and enjoy! You may also pair this with a fresh salad or pita bread.
